Get started

Search and replace these keywords and variables

Package name : @package Wordpress_Starter
Class : Wordpress_Starter
Constant : WORDPRESS_STARTER
Text domain : wordpress-starter

Change this filename

File to change : class-wordpress-starter.php
It should match your class name with dashes and lowercase letters
If your class name is New_Name the file should be class-new-name.php

CSS

Run npm run sass-watch in the terminal
Compiles assets/sass folder to assets/css/main
This is your main css folder

Color

You can find all the sass, css variables and css classes for color under sass/abstracts/variables/_colors.scss
Create, edit and rename what you want to use

Typography

You can find all the default typography styles under sass/abstracts/variables/_typography.scss
All the main typogrophy element styles are under sass/base/typography/.*
Edit what you want to use

Global

A lot of the components use these classes so many components have consistency in spacing and design

.section
Adds padding for top and bottom
See sass/utilities/_section.scss

.container
Adds a max-width to the main container of a component with a left and right padding or margin
See sass/utilities/_container.scss

Color Palette

Add colors to class-wordpress-starter.php Line 139
Make sure the slug of added colors matches what you have in assets/sass/abstracts/variables/_colors.scss
